A well-appointed one bedroom, first floor retirement apartment with a pleasant outlook over communal gardens and within easy walking distance of the town's amenities. The property offers bright and well-appointed living accommodation, together with use of the communal sitting room and gardens. No upward chain.
Custerson Court - Custerson Court is a desirable development of retirement apartments located in a convenient town centre location, within 10 minutes' walk of Waitrose. The development has a resident house manager and each apartment has 24 hour emergency alarm cords in every room. The communal areas include a spacious residents' lounge, laundry room, waste and recycling room and well-kept communal gardens with plentiful parking for residents and visitors. The upper floors are accessible via a lift.
Ground Floor -
Communal Entrance Hall - Secure entrance door with access to communal hallway providing access to the lift system and staircase.
First Floor -
Private Entrance Hall - Entrance door, built-in storage cupboard with shelving and doors to adjoining rooms.
Sitting Room - Double glazed window with a southerly aspect overlooking the communal gardens and door opening to a Juliet balcony. Doors to:
Kitchen - Fitted with a range of base and eye level units with worktop space over, four ring induction hob with extractor hood over, integrated oven, stainless steel sink unit, fridge and freezer. Double glazed windows overlooking the gardens.
Double Bedroom - Double glazed window overlooking the communal gardens and built-in wardrobes.
Shower Room - Comprising low level WC, shower enclosure, ceramic wash basin with vanity cupboard beneath, heated towel rail and tiled walls with handrails.
Outside - Delightful well maintained, large communal gardens, together with ample parking facilities.
Leasehold - Lease Length: 125 years from 1 May 1995 (95 years remaining)
Ground Rent: £514.14 p.a.
Service Charge: £3,137.62 p.a.
Viewings - By appointment through the Agents.
